Removing Paint Contaminants from Exterior Paint
Removing paint contaminants such as rail dust and industrial fallout from exterior paint.
Technical Background
Industrial fallout in most cases is rail dust (small air borne metal particles) that are thrown into the air from rail
trains or vehicle brake linings. When it lands on the vehicle it may stay on the surface until the paint is properly
cleaned.

Directions for Use:
Note:
DO NOT use in direct sunlight or on a hot surface.
 Wash and rinse vehicle thoroughly
using 3M™ Body Shop Clean-Up Car
Wash Soap (Figure 1). Follow
instructions on the product label.
 Check exterior surfaces using your
hand to feel for a rough or gritty texture,
indicating contaminants.

 If contaminants are found, work affected
areas with 3M™ Perfect-It III™ Cleaner
Clay (Figure 2) following instructions on
the product label. Use the 3M™ Car
Wash Shampoo as a lubricant. Repeat
as necessary.
Figure 2
Tip:
To reduce scratching, knead clay periodically and store in container.
WARNING:
Dispose of bar when contamination becomes excessive.
